## Schema Registry On-Call Notes

The Pylon event schema registry at Ostrander Labs enforces compatibility checks on every publish. If the registry's admin store locks after repeated failed logins, on-call must perform a manual unlock from the primary node console. Page the data platform lead first. Unlock using the recovery passphrase below.

vault phrase of taweg-kafof = oliax-zorael

Eng sync, week 32 — password reset revamp (project Lockmere). Discussed replacing the legacy token emailer with short-lived signed links; agreed on 15-minute expiry and single-use enforcement. Rate limiting per account, not per IP, to blunt enumeration. Copy changes pending legal review. Rollout behind a flag to 5% next week, with metrics on abandonment. Open questions on SMS fallback were assigned to the owner listed below.

signatory, fafog-bagef: Jorwyn Juleth Pelius

Runbook: Tollbridge session-refresh incident. Quick version for release management: refreshed tokens occasionally inherit the previous session's expiry, so users get logged out mid-request or, worse, stay logged in too long. Mitigation is to restart the Fennelcrest auth pods in rolling order (never all at once — it drops the refresh queue). Hold the 4.2 release until the hotfix lands. Before restarting anything, verify the live values against the expected configuration shown below.

config for bagep-kageg:
ULADOR_LOG_LEVEL=warn
ULADOR_METRICS_HOST=metrics.ulador.tolvaqcorp.corp
ULADOR_POOL_SIZE=32

Runbook: Account Recovery — Retrying Failed Exports (Quillbox)

So a customer's export job died mid-run and now their account is stuck in "export pending" limbo. Happens more than we'd like. First, clear the stale lock from the Quillbox export queue, then re-trigger the job from the admin panel — don't just tell them to click retry, it won't work while the lock exists. If the account itself got flagged during the failure, you'll need to run the recovery script, which prompts for the passphrase below.

unlock words, hahip-yagef: zorok-novmir-zorix-silax